French supermajor TotalEnergies and Saudi oil giant Aramco will build a massive petrochemical complex in Saudi Arabia worth $11 billion, the two companies said in a joint statement on Thursday. The “Amiral” petrochemical complex will be owned, operated, and integrated with the existing SATORP refinery in Jubail on Saudi Arabia’s eastern coast.
